关于本地连接虚拟机(centos)里的mongodb失败问题
我把mongodb数据库安装在虚拟机上(centos),虚拟机上是可以连接成功的。
然后呢 我想在本机上(window8)使用MongoVUE.exe客户端软件连接虚拟机(centos)上的mongodb 连接却报错了,连接不上!
ping虚拟机的时候是可以ping通的
解决方法,关掉防火墙,
service iptables status 查看iptables状态
service iptables restart iptables服务重启
service iptables stop iptables服务禁用
禁用了之后,发现可以访问了,不论是页面还是数据库,都可以了。
1) 永久性生效,重启后不会复原
开启: chkconfig iptables on
关闭: chkconfig iptables off
2) 即时生效,重启后复原
开启: service iptables start
关闭: service iptables stop
查询TCP连接情况:
netstat -n | awk '/^tcp/ {++S[$NF]} END {for(a in S) print a, S[a]}'
查询端口占用情况:
netstat -anp | grep portno(例如:netstat –apn | grep 80)